A remarkable regiocontrol in the palladium-catalyzed silylstannylation of fluoroalkylated alkynes – highly regio- and stereoselective synthesis of multi-substituted fluorine-containing alkenes
On treating fluorine-containing internal alkynes with 1.2 equiv. of (trimethylsilyl)tributyltin in the presence of 2.5 mol% of Pd(PPh3)2Cl2 in THF at the reflux temperature for 6 h, the silylstannylation reaction proceeded smoothly to afford the corresponding silylstannylated adducts in high yields in a highly regio- and cis-selective manner.
